Cannot search in Acrobat Reader DC (works in Chrome and Firefox)

  • September 8, 2020
  • 0 replies
  • 241 views

File attached.

All text highlightable and copyable.

Acrobat Reader DC 2020.012.20043 on Windows 10.

Other pdfs work fine.

 

When I initially open the pdf:
If I search for 1234, it only matches the last 9 characters in each row (890123456). All 9 characters are highlighted (not just 1234). No other 1234 is matched/highlighted.

If I search for 5678, it says no results.

 

I tried disabling fast find:

If I search for 1234, it now matches and highlights the whole first page as one result, and the second page as the second result.

If I search for 5678, it finds and highlights each individual row (except for the last 9 characters).

 

If I open the pdf in Chrome, it works perfectly.

If I open the pdf in Firefox, it works perfectly.
